Transaction 287956778563f7c91a1754d7ddba0a546e8d21261efb3c13e2fad05365269868

1 Input
2 Outputs
  • 287956778563f7c91a1754d7ddba0a546e8d21261efb3c13e2fad05365269868:0
  • value  520310
    address  14Vw2jp6NNTMMrfBgoNC8zj8qYDaXH1mqq
  • 287956778563f7c91a1754d7ddba0a546e8d21261efb3c13e2fad05365269868:1
  • value  18311094
    address  1D3cVFehNVnSHA8qxi9149u8jiDAZLveoQ